Cracking Up

Cracking Up!’ uses comedy and drama to raise awareness on stigmas around mental health.

John Parker Cracking Up will be showing at the Bernie Grants Art Centre on the Tuesday 20th October 2009 from 7:30pm, there are 150 free tickets. To request for a free ticket, please call 020 8489 8840 or email
